alto al fuego is aSpanishphrase. It means: Interrupción, en principio temporal, de una guerra o de cualquier conflicto armado en la que los bandos enfrentados acuerdan, mutua o unilateralmente, el cese de las hostilidades. Pronounced [ˈal̪t̪o al ˈfweɣ̞o].
